Alicia Menendez's journey began in Union City, New Jersey, where she was born on July 2, 1983. Growing up in a politically engaged household, with her father, Bob Menendez, serving as a U.S. Senator, undoubtedly influenced her career path. She pursued her education at Harvard College, graduating in 2005. This strong academic foundation provided her with the tools and knowledge to excel in the fast-paced world of media.
Her career in journalism has been marked by versatility and a commitment to insightful reporting. She gained early experience with appearances on major news networks, including CNN and Fox News Channel, honing her skills as a commentator. This wide exposure gave her a platform to share her perspectives on a variety of topics, from politics to culture. This experience helped her in developing a unique voice.
Currently, Menendez serves as an anchor and correspondent for MSNBC, where she hosts the weekend show "American Voices with Alicia Menendez." Her program has quickly become a staple for viewers seeking in-depth analysis and perspectives on current events. She is known for her insightful interviews and engaging discussions, providing viewers with a comprehensive understanding of complex issues.

Beyond her anchoring duties, Menendez has also established herself as an author. In 2019, she published "The Likeability Trap: How to Break Free and Succeed as You Are," a book that delves into the societal pressures women face and provides a roadmap for achieving success while remaining authentic. This book highlights her dedication to empowering others.
Further adding to her diverse portfolio, Menendez is a contributing editor at Bustle and hosts the "Latina to Latina" podcast. Through these platforms, she engages in discussions with prominent Latinas, offering insights into their experiences and celebrating their achievements. This demonstrates her dedication to uplifting voices and promoting diversity within media.
Her career trajectory also includes a stint as a correspondent for "Amanpour & Company" on PBS and hosting Fusion's "Come Here and Say That", further illustrating her versatility and commitment to various media platforms.
Alicia Menendez's personal life is also a significant aspect of her story. She is married to Carlos Prio Odio, a public relations executive and political strategist. The couple married in 2015 in Coral Gables, Florida. Odio, whose grandfather, Carlos Prio Socarras, served as the president of Cuba from 1948 to 1952, brings a unique perspective to the relationship.
Together, they have two daughters, Evangelina and Ofelia, and reside in Miami. Carlos Prio Odio, known as the husband of Alicia Menendez, has also forged his own successful career. Notably, he served as the Deputy Latino Vote Director for Barack Obama's staff during the 2008 presidential campaign. This political experience underscores his expertise in public relations and strategic communications. He has built a name for himself through his career, just like his wife.
